Snakes Seek Higher Ground in Telangana Amid Flooding

Snakes have been finding their way into residential areas in Telangana in quest of higher land due to severe rainfall and flooding. A big python entered a residence in Venkatesh Nagar, Khammam district, requiring the arrival of a snake rescue team. Pythons have also been spotted in other parts of Hyderabad, including Puranapul and Kukatpally. Many households, businesses, and industries on the city’s outskirts have also reported snake sightings as a result of the flooding produced by the constant rain.

To address such circumstances and maintain inhabitants’ safety, it is critical to understand what procedures to follow if a snake enters a residential area or house. In the event of a snake sighting, homeowners should call the Friends of Snakes Society at 8374233366. This group specializes in the safe and humane handling and rescue of snakes.

Snakes may return to their natural habitats once water levels decrease and flooding diminishes. In the meanwhile, folks must be attentive and take the appropriate precautions to avoid any potential snake encounters. Keeping the surrounds clean, removing any trash, and sealing off any access points can all assist to limit the possibility of Snakes seeking shelter in residential settings during these harsh weather conditions.
